Zephyr for Jira vs Linear
psychology AI Verdict
Zephyr for Jira excels in its specialized integration with Atlassian Jira, offering advanced test case management and detailed reporting capabilities that are crucial for software testing teams. However, Linear's minimalist interface and developer-centric workflow make it a standout choice for high-velocity teams. While Zephyr for Jira provides robust issue linking and comprehensive reporting tools, Linears focus on speed and ease of use sets it apart by significantly reducing the time developers spend on administrative tasks.
This makes Linear particularly appealing to startups and tech companies where rapid development cycles are the norm. Despite these differences, both tools offer strong value propositions in their respective domains; Zephyr for Jira is indispensable for teams deeply integrated with Atlassians ecosystem, while Linear shines for those prioritizing speed and simplicity.

compare Feature Comparison
| Feature | Zephyr for Jira | Linear |
|---|---|---|
| Test Case Management | Advanced and comprehensive | Basic but sufficient |
| Issue Linking | Seamless integration with Atlassian Jira | Limited functionality |
| Reporting Capabilities | Detailed and robust | Simplified reporting tools |
| User Interface | Complex but feature-rich | Intuitive and streamlined |
| Speed of Operations | Moderate speed due to integration complexity | Very fast, optimized for speed |
| Pricing Model | Competitive within Atlassian ecosystem | More affordable and cost-effective |
